National News: India is soon going to be equipped with a technology that was seen only in Hollywood's science fiction films. The Indian Defense Research and Development Organization (DRDO) is working on a state -of -the -art laser weapon system, which will demolish the enemy's drones, missiles and fighter aircraft in an eye.

Successful testing from 30 kW beam

DRDO recently tested a laser truck -based weapon system in the Chandipur range of Odisha, using a 30 kW laser beam. This beam made the target located 3.5 km to ashes in seconds. This experiment is considered to be a major milestone in the defense sector of India.

Fighter jets and missiles will fall from 80-100 kW beam

Experts believe that if India develops a laser beam from 80 to 100 kW, this weapon will be able to pile any enemy fighter aircraft and missiles in the air itself. This will make India's air defense system impregnable.

The world already in the race for laser war

  • America: 55 kW laser system deployed in the Navy.
  •  
  • China: 37 kW mobile laser armed.
  •  
  • Israel: Develop powerful laser systems against missiles and rocket attacks.


India's jump, step towards self -sufficiency

This technology of India is not just a jump towards modernity, but a concrete step towards self -sufficient India. In the coming years, the Indian Army will have such a weapon that will change the rules of traditional war.


DRDO chief claim

According to DRDO chief Sameer V. Kamat, India is soon on the verge of achieving "Technology like Star Wars". He said that the strength of laser weapons will increase the firepower of the army manifold.
